This 4.3-mile stretch of land reaches out into Kachemak Bay like an arm waving hello to the Kenai Mountain Range on the opposite shore. Part of an underwater moraine from an extinct tidewater glacier, Homer Spit provides a hub for adventures of every sort from tidepooling and kayaking to bear viewing and halibut fishing, along with 360-degree views of the turquoise-blue waters, glaciers and bluffs surrounding the spit of land. Here, you can watch boats—commercial, charters, cruise liners, ferries on the Alaska Marine Highway and even U.S. Coast Guard vessels— dock and load while bald eagles circle overhead.
